Intelligent face identification camera
Technical Field
The utility model relates to a camera technical field specifically is an intelligent face identification camera.
Background
Face identification camera is more and more common in people's production life, through being equipped with face identification module in the camera, can exchange and compare with high in the clouds server storage data, can realize intelligent control through cell-phone APP.
The outside casing of intelligence face identification camera on the market at present is mostly a body design, inconvenient split, and the later stage can only the whole change if inside spare part damages to lead to monitoring out the problem, and the higher inconvenient maintenance of cost because the camera is installed at high higher wall body more, inconvenient clearance uses the dust more for a long time, also can influence the definition of control. Therefore, an intelligent face recognition camera is designed, the intelligent face recognition camera has a self-dedusting function, the service life is longer, and a monitoring picture is clearer.

Example 1: referring to fig. 1-4, an intelligent face recognition camera comprises an installation seat 1 and a support 21, wherein one side of the support 21 is integrally connected with the installation seat 1, the other side of the support 21 is movably hinged with a hinged shaft 19, a rotating pin 20 is installed between the hinged shaft 19 and the support 21, the bottom end of the hinged shaft 19 is fixedly connected with an upper shell 2, the bottom end of the upper shell 2 is movably connected with a lower shell 9, a threaded rod 4 is installed at the middle position inside the lower shell 9, two groups of threaded blocks 16 are movably sleeved outside the threaded rod 4, a second driving motor 15 is arranged on the other side of the bottom end of the threaded rod 4, a fixed seat 12 is fixedly connected at the bottom end inside the lower shell 9, a protection plate 11 is integrally connected at the bottom end of the fixed seat 12, and a face recognition camera module 10 is movably connected at the bottom end outside the lower shell 9;
a transmission belt and a transmission wheel are arranged between the output end of the second driving motor 15 and the threaded rod 4, the bottom ends of the threaded blocks 16 are respectively and movably hinged with a hinged rod 5, the bottom ends of the hinged rods 5 are respectively and movably hinged with a connecting plate 14, two sides of the bottom end of the connecting plate 14 are respectively provided with a silica gel block 6, the inner side of each silica gel block 6 is provided with a brush 13, internal threads matched with the threaded rod 4 are arranged inside each threaded block 16, and the directions of the internal threads of the threaded blocks 16 are opposite;
specifically, as shown in fig. 1, fig. 2 and fig. 4, silica gel block 6 and brush 13 are daily put inside lower shell 9, when face recognition camera module 10 needs to remove dust, second driving motor 15 is started, the output end of second driving motor 15 drives threaded rod 4 to rotate through drive wheel and drive belt, thereby drive two sets of threaded blocks 16 to move relatively, 5-degree overturn of hinge rod pushes connecting plate 14 downwards, silica gel block 6 and brush 13 pass respectively from two sets of through grooves 23 of fixing base 12 and insert downwards in slot 22 of guard plate 11, thereby it can reach from dust removal effect with brush 13 frictional contact to drive the camera rotation through first driving motor 7, the functionality of the camera has been enriched, even install the eminence and also be convenient for clean the maintenance, the monitoring picture is more clear.
Example 2: through grooves 23 are respectively formed in two sides of the interior of the fixed seat 12, a first driving motor 7 is installed at the top end of the fixed seat 12, a first driving shaft 8 is arranged at the output end of the first driving motor 7, the bottom end of the first driving shaft 8 penetrates through the interior of the fixed seat 12 and is in specified connection with the face recognition camera module 10, slots 22 are respectively formed in two sides of the fixed seat 12, the slots 22 penetrate through two sides of the inner wall of the fixed seat 12, and the slots 22 are matched with the silica gel blocks 6 in size;
specifically, as shown in fig. 1, fig. 2 and fig. 4, the output of first driving motor 7 passes through the shaft coupling and drives face identification camera module 10 and rotate, realizes 360 all around rotation, and guard plate 11 plays the guard action to the camera, can effectively prevent water droplet landing, also can be crashproof, and spherical face identification camera module 10 is shot with monitoring range is bigger, and accessible face is shot and is realized wireless transmission intelligence with high in the clouds data and compare the function.
Example 3: a third driving motor 18 is mounted at the top end inside the upper shell 2, the output end of the third driving motor 18 is fixedly connected with a third driving shaft 17 through a coupler, the third driving shaft 17 penetrates through the bottom end of the upper shell 2 and the top end of the lower shell 9 and is fixedly connected with a connecting piece 3, the connecting piece 3 is movably connected with the lower shell 9, assembling screws 24 are respectively arranged on two sides of two ends of the top of the lower shell 9, and the lower shell 9 can be detached from the upper shell 2 through the assembling screws 24;
specifically, as shown in fig. 1 and 3, third driving motor 18 drives third drive shaft through the shaft coupling and rotates 17, connection piece 3 improves the leakproofness of casing 2 and casing 9 down, through the whole 360 rotations of casing 9 under the third driving motor 18 drives, cooperation first driving motor 7 is in the rotation in inside, the flexibility of using is improved, it is swing joint to go up casing 2 and casing 9 down, can make casing 9 and last casing 2 carry out the dismouting down through assembly screw 24, be convenient for the maintenance of inside spare part, save the later stage and change spare part cost.
